Mister VCS Posted October 23, 2010 Share Posted October 23, 2010 (edited) Peter Pepper the chef moves around the screen walking over the parts of a hamburger. As each item is walked over it drops to the level below. Armed with pepper he can throw on his enemies, he must avoid Mr. Hotdog, Mr. Egg, and Mr. Pickle. Bonus appear in the form of ice cream, coffee, and french fries.
